PM Ponta: Sole PNL candidate worthy of being presidential competitor is Crin Antonescu

Photo credit: (c) Cristian NISTOR / AGERPRES PHOTO

Prime Minister Victor Ponta has stated on Thursday that if the Social Liberal Union (USL) had still existed, he would have never ran against Crin Antonescu in the presidential elections and that he considers the former National Liberal Party (PNL) chairman as the sole potential presidential competitor from PNL and the Democratic Liberal Party (PDL).

"I always told my colleagues that I will never run for PSD [Social Democrat Party] chairmanship against Adrian Nastase. In 2010, five days before the PSD Congress, Adrian Nastase announced he is withdrawing and then I announced my candidacy, on Saturday, and I won. Crin Antonescu knows full well, because for three years I've seen him more than I saw my family, that I would've never ran against him. If USL had still existed, I wouldn't run, if USL returns and we rebuild what we said we'd do, yes, I'll withdraw. If the situation is as is now, I will surely run against him", said Ponta at private online broadcaster DC News.

He added that the only candidate that could reach the second round of the presidential elections and who is a worthy competitor is Crin Antonescu.

"Surely, he who enters the second round will be a powerful candidate and it's going to be a tight result. The only candidate [from the right-wing] who is worthy of the presidential seat is definitely Crin Antonescu, because if you want to be the president of a country you need to have a certain vision, a certain level in internal politics, in foreign politics, to raise hopes, expectations, to say "choose me as President because this is how I see Romania".
